From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 Date: Sat, 9 Sep 1995 10:50:19 -0400 From: Kenji Okamoto okamoto@earth.cias.osakafu-u.ac.jp Subject: two CDROM drives got success Topicbox-Message-UUID: 225bd5c2-eac8-11e9-9e20-41e7f4b1d025 Message-ID: <19950909145019.nizkNqpIlgB_1Dhq9fR8A681zURF3SDpa_ExMgCJIXY@z> Recently, I reported two scsi CDROM drives, Chinon's CDA-535 and Sony's CDU-561, were difficult to use on AHA1542B. However, it was wrong, now I can report, with pleasure, that they can work fine. By the support of forsyth@plan9.cs.york.ac.uk, I checked again those drives, and found they behave somewhat different from Chinon's CDS-431, but work fine. For CDS-431, the command term% bind -a '#R6" /dev worked fine, but for the others, alternative command term% bind -a '#w6' /dev was nessessary. This solved all the problem (Thanks forsyth _o_). The last question left is why the latter two drives does not report their size in the initial booting mode still in CGA, such scsi6: cap 23365 sec 2048.....
